Output 6539f2b027a726a24cf6dd1c7e34166b8683e624efc4eedb2d3ccaf63d5b6302:7

value
1930489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c50086270ac73b27fa1f294391b14c05dd5dcb6 OP_EQUAL
address
3EUvQAzcEXi773Gr8yENteXaFpTKcwZYtL
transaction
6539f2b027a726a24cf6dd1c7e34166b8683e624efc4eedb2d3ccaf63d5b6302